Nice clean and recently renovated property. But the best thing was the *amazing* buffet breakfasts (included in the stay). Lots of choices, let's just say I over-indulged in the smoked salmon. Jams, pickled herring, other toppings, variety of breads (with a toaster of course), OJ and apple juice, fruit, tomatoes (locally grown, I think), rolls. Great coffee machine (except how do you adjust the strength? looks like it's possible, but I couldn't get it to work). If you're going on tours (which you should, unless you have a car), I think the nearest pickup place is the Hotel Island, less than a quarter mile away. Ask the concierge to point it out (or just look on your phone's map).

It's about a 1 1/2 mile (2km) walk to restaurant row in Reykjavik. You'll pass a couple others that are closer, but I didn't check them out. Also about 2 miles from the FlyBus terminal (tour buses start and end there too, but they'll drop you off at the Hotel Island). Hotels in Europe seem to all have quilt covers instead of separate sheet + blanket. I found the quilt too warm.

We checked in with a very professional and polite young lady. We had a small but cozy room on the first floor. Property was immaculate. We had a large, comfortable bathroom with great hot water. The building offers great security with door codes to get in. The dining area downstairs was lovely with art work and beautiful table settings. They offer a delicious cold cut buffet with breads, pastries, fruits, veggies, cereals, juices, tea, and coffee machine. They also have a chiller available with beers, wines, and sodas that can be purchased. The location has a small grocery just steps away and a delicious pizza restaurant within a short walking distance. They have their parking lot just a few steps outside the front door. Easy to get luggage in and out. They have delicious chocolates! Would definitely stay here again.
